問(wèn)題描述:關(guān)于云鎖怎么關(guān)閉訪問(wèn)權(quán)限這個(gè)問(wèn)題,大家能幫我解決一下嗎?
回答:真相只有一個(gè)!你的設(shè)計(jì)太水了。。我在有一個(gè)問(wèn)題《數(shù)據(jù)庫(kù)什么時(shí)候會(huì)死鎖》的回答中提到了,數(shù)據(jù)庫(kù)為了保證數(shù)據(jù)的一致性,防止并發(fā)對(duì)數(shù)據(jù)正確性的影響,通常會(huì)使用加鎖的方式!而一共有表級(jí)鎖,行級(jí)鎖和頁(yè)面鎖三種鎖粒度,鎖又有共享鎖(通常用于讀數(shù)據(jù))和獨(dú)占鎖(通常用于寫(xiě)數(shù)據(jù))等的區(qū)分!關(guān)于數(shù)據(jù)庫(kù)鎖機(jī)制發(fā)生死鎖的原因,請(qǐng)參考我的那篇回答,回到這個(gè)提問(wèn)上來(lái),為什么數(shù)據(jù)庫(kù)經(jīng)常鎖表?鎖表的意思很明顯,就是表數(shù)據(jù)被鎖,導(dǎo)...
回答:違反。gpl只要你用了就得開(kāi)源。看你的描述目標(biāo)是鎖定root源碼,你可以自己開(kāi)發(fā)鎖定那一塊,然后linux核心調(diào)用你的代碼,這樣就可以閉源。注意閉源的關(guān)鍵是你的代碼不能調(diào)用linux任何方法
回答:- Web 基礎(chǔ)曾經(jīng)開(kāi)源中國(guó)創(chuàng)始人紅薯寫(xiě)了一篇文章「初學(xué) Java Web 開(kāi)發(fā),請(qǐng)遠(yuǎn)離各種框架,從 Servlet 開(kāi)發(fā)」,我覺(jué)得他說(shuō)的太對(duì)了,在如今 Java 開(kāi)發(fā)中,很多開(kāi)發(fā)者只知道怎么使用框架,但根本不懂 Web 的一些知識(shí)點(diǎn),其實(shí)框架很多,但都基本是一個(gè)套路,所以在你學(xué)習(xí)任何框架前,請(qǐng)把 Web 基礎(chǔ)打好,把 Web 基礎(chǔ)打好了,看框架真的是如魚(yú)得水。關(guān)于 Http 協(xié)議,這篇文章就寫(xiě)得...
...有,對(duì)象被封閉在該線(xiàn)程中,并且只能由這個(gè)線(xiàn)程修改 只讀共享:在沒(méi)有額外同步的情況下,共享的只讀對(duì)象可以由多個(gè)線(xiàn)程并發(fā)訪問(wèn),但任何線(xiàn)程都不能修改它,共享的只讀對(duì)象包括不可變對(duì)象和事實(shí)不可變對(duì)象。 線(xiàn)程安...
...現(xiàn)接口 ReadWriteLock, 該接口維護(hù)了一對(duì)相關(guān)的鎖, 一個(gè)用于只讀操作, 另一個(gè)用于寫(xiě)入操作. 只要沒(méi)有 writer, 讀取鎖可以由多個(gè) reader 線(xiàn)程同時(shí)保持. 寫(xiě)入鎖是獨(dú)占的. public interface ReadWriteLock { Lock readLock(); Lock writeLock(); } ReadWrit...
...所謂讀寫(xiě)鎖,是一對(duì)相關(guān)的鎖——讀鎖和寫(xiě)鎖,讀鎖用于只讀操作,寫(xiě)鎖用于寫(xiě)入操作。讀鎖可以由多個(gè)線(xiàn)程同時(shí)保持,而寫(xiě)鎖是獨(dú)占的,只能由一個(gè)線(xiàn)程獲取。 3.1 接口定義 3.2 使用注意 讀寫(xiě)鎖的阻塞情況如下圖: 舉個(gè)例子...
...監(jiān)聽(tīng)器list而言是寫(xiě)操作,而通知監(jiān)聽(tīng)器訪問(wèn)監(jiān)聽(tīng)器list是只讀操作。由于通過(guò)通知訪問(wèn)是讀操作,因此是可以多個(gè)通知操作同時(shí)進(jìn)行的。 因此,只要沒(méi)有監(jiān)聽(tīng)器注冊(cè)或撤銷(xiāo)注冊(cè),任意多的并發(fā)通知都可以同時(shí)執(zhí)行,而不會(huì)引發(fā)對(duì)...
...對(duì)象,由線(xiàn)程獨(dú)占,并且只能被占有它的線(xiàn)程修改2.共享只讀 : 一個(gè)共享只讀的對(duì)象,在沒(méi)有額外同步的情況下,可以被多個(gè)線(xiàn)程并發(fā)訪問(wèn),但是任何線(xiàn)程都不能修改它3.線(xiàn)程安全對(duì)象 : 一個(gè)線(xiàn)程安全的對(duì)象或則容器,在內(nèi)部通...
...變量。ReadWriteLock能提供比獨(dú)占鎖更高的并發(fā)性。而對(duì)于只讀的數(shù)據(jù)結(jié)構(gòu),其中包含的不變性可以完全不需要加鎖操作。 public class ReadWriteMap { private final Map map; private final ReadWriteLock lock = new ReentrantReadWriteLock(); privat...
...對(duì)象,由線(xiàn)程獨(dú)占,并且只能被占有它的線(xiàn)程修改 共享只讀:一個(gè)共享只讀的對(duì)象,在沒(méi)有額外同步的情況下,可以被多個(gè)線(xiàn)程并發(fā)訪問(wèn),但是任何線(xiàn)程都不能修改它 線(xiàn)程安全對(duì)象:一個(gè)線(xiàn)程安全的對(duì)象或者容器,在內(nèi)部通...
...,一個(gè)人打開(kāi)文件,其他人再無(wú)法打開(kāi)或者只打開(kāi)該文件只讀拷貝并且不能修改(好的并發(fā)設(shè)計(jì)應(yīng)該是:找到各種創(chuàng)建隔離區(qū)的辦法,并且保證在每個(gè)隔離區(qū)里能夠完成盡可能多的任務(wù)) 2)不變性: 方案1: 識(shí)別哪些是不變的...
...包含的所有鍵值對(duì)。為了描述方便,我們?cè)诤竺婧?jiǎn)稱(chēng)它為只讀字典。不過(guò),只讀字典雖然不會(huì)增減其中的鍵,但卻允許變更其中的鍵所對(duì)應(yīng)的值。所以,它并不是傳統(tǒng)意義上的快照,它的只讀特性只是對(duì)于其中鍵的集合而言的。...
...eadLocal類(lèi)。內(nèi)部維護(hù)了每個(gè)線(xiàn)程和變量的一個(gè)獨(dú)立副本 只讀共享。即使用不可變的對(duì)象。 使用final去修飾字段,這樣這個(gè)字段的值是不可改變的 注意final如果修飾的是一個(gè)對(duì)象引用,比如set,它本身包含的值是可變的 創(chuàng)...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
營(yíng)銷(xiāo)賬號(hào)總被封?TK直播頻繁掉線(xiàn)?雙ISP靜態(tài)住宅IP+輕量云主機(jī)打包套餐來(lái)襲,確保開(kāi)出來(lái)的云主機(jī)不...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說(shuō)合適,...